Skip to content

blakegreendev/blakegreen-dev

Repository files navigation

Kick-off your Portfolio website. We have used Gatsby + Contenful.

Pictures from:

Live Demo:

https://blakegreen.dev

Feature:

  • Blogs listing with each blog post.
  • Contact form with Email notification using formspree.io.
  • Photos and Blogs page listing.
  • Different types of sections like About, Service, Blogs, Work, Testimonials, Photos, and contact.
  • All settings manage from contentful for example Header Menu, Homepage sections, blogs, and photos, etc.
  • Social share in blog details pages with comment ( Disqus ).
  • PWA

🚀 Quick start

  1. Setup this site.

    Use the Gatsby CLI to Clone this site.

    # Clone this Repositories
    gatsby new portfolio https://github.com/bgreengo/blakegreen-dev.git
  2. Setup Contentful Models

    Use contentful-cli to import the models from contentful-data.json

    contentful space --space-id <CONTENTFUL_SPACE_ID> import --content-file contentful-data.json
    

    Checkout Rohit's

  3. Start developing.

    Navigate into your new site’s directory and start it up.

    cd blakegreen-dev
    npm install
    gatsby develop
  4. Setup your Own Configure Projects.

    Enter your own key

    ContentFul:

    • spaceId: Key
    • accessToken: Key
  5. Open the source code and start editing!

    Your site is now running at http://localhost:8000!

    Note: You'll also see a second link: http://localhost:8000/___graphql. This is a tool you can use to experiment with querying your data. Learn more about using this tool in the Gatsby tutorial.

    Open the rg-portfolio directory in your code editor of choice and edit src/pages/index.js. Save your changes and the browser will update in real time!

🎓 Learning Gatsby

Looking for more guidance? Full documentation for Gatsby lives on the website. Here are some places to start:

  • For most developers, we recommend starting with our in-depth tutorial for creating a site with Gatsby. It starts with zero assumptions about your level of ability and walks through every step of the process.

  • To dive straight into code samples, head to our documentation. In particular, check out the Guides, API Reference, and Advanced Tutorials sections in the sidebar.

💫 Deploy

Deploy to Netlify

About

New blog.. who dis?

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published